Increase the visibility of your expertise and research

You can create an Researcher / expert profile with the Researcher’s Profile Tool in the Ministry of Education and Culture’s Research.fi service. All researchers in higher education and research institutions and people working in expert positions, regardless of their title, are encouraged to use it.

With a Researcher profile you can promote your competences and expertise the way you want. The profile information is available to you regardless of changes in affiliations or job titles.

To create a Researcher profile, you will need an ORCID profile. To access your Researcher profile in Research.fi, you must use a strong Suomi.fi e-Identification.

ORCID researcher identifier

The international ORCID researcher identifier is a persistent and unique digital identifier for researchers. It is a 16-digit number that distinguishes researchers from each other.

By creating an ORCID profile for yourself and linking it to your professional information you will ensure that your research outputs are correctly attributed to you. ORCID acts like a signature that you can attach to your online presence, such as articles, web pages, blog posts, social media, CV, and email signature.

  • Over time, using an ORCID will reduce the need to repeatedly enter the same personal and publication information into different systems.
  • Scholarly publishers may require authors and peer reviewers to have an ORCID.
  • Many funders may also require an ORCID.
  • Many universities expect their postgraduate students to have an ORCID.

ORCID is a non-proprietary and community-based registry of unique identifiers for researchers and authors. Community members include individual researchers, authors, publishers (e.g. Elsevier), universities (e.g. MIT), research institutes (e.g. CERN), and scholarly associations.

Research activities

The service for saving research activity information in JUSTUS closes down on 30.11.2025 (see Messi

Research activities are part of your visibility as an expert. A research activity can be an expert task related to RDI, teaching, or other professional activities. It can be, for example, a conference presentation, poster, or thesis supervision.

Research activities are often comparable in importance to other professional outputs, such as publications, so they are worth collecting and showcasing to promote your own merit and visibility of your expertise.

Save your research activity information regularly in the Turku UAS JUSTUS service. You can publish them as part of your Researcher / expert profile on Research.fi or use the downloadable csv file from JUSTUS, depending on your needs. You are responsible for the accuracy of your research activity information, and you decide which activities you choose to show in your Researcher / expert profile.

Benefits of saving research activities

  • Improved visibility of how diverse expert work is.
    • In addition to publications and research data, other research activities are a significant part of many experts’ work, both in terms of workload and importance.
  • Research activities gain national and international visibility.
    • Experts can gain national and international visibility for their research activities by including the information in their researcher profile on the Ministry of Education and Culture’s national research information repository, Tiedejatutkimus.fi.
    • Information can also be transferred to other services you may use.
    • Through the Research activity service, information is imported to VIRTA publication information service and the expert/researcher profile tool (note: there may be a delay in the data import).
  • Service improves the quality of metadata for research activities.
    • The information collected through the Research activity service is up to date according to the nationally defined metadata model, see code list.
  • Service is easy to use.
    • Logging into the JUSTUS service uses the organisation’s own login (e.g., HAKA), so there is no need to create separate credentials for the service.
    • Your name, unit, and ORCID information are automatically populated in the online form.
